Identifying Genuine Hull Silver: Expert Tips
When it comes to vintage silver jewelry, identifying genuine Hull silver is a crucial step in securing a unique and valuable accessory. Hull silver, often marked with the ‘HS’ or ‘Hull’ stamp, is known for its intricate designs and craftsmanship. However, with imitations and fakes circulating in the market, it’s essential to be an informed buyer.
One of the most reliable methods to verify authenticity is by checking the weight. Genuine Hull silver pieces typically weigh heavier due to the higher purity of the metal. Experts suggest using a precise scale to measure the weight against known standards. Additionally, examining the hallmarks or stamps on the jewelry is vital. Look for markings like ‘925’ indicating sterling silver purity, and ‘HS’ or ‘Hull’ for the specific manufacturer. These details provide valuable insights into the piece’s authenticity and make it easier to identify genuine Hull silver items.
